[PATCH net-next 01/10] net: hns3: Support for dynamically assigning tx buffer to TC

From: Yunsheng Lin
Date: Thu Sep 21 2017 - 07:25:07 EST


This patch add support of dynamically assigning tx buffer to
TC when the TC is enabled.
It will save buffer for rx direction to avoid packet loss.
